Understanding Robocall Laws in the US and Abroad
Robocalls, automated telephone calls made en masse, have become a pervasive issue globally, with overseas call centers posing significant challenges for legal authorities and consumers alike. In the United States, robocall laws are governed by federal regulations, primarily the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A), which restricts the use of automated dialing systems and prerecorded messages without prior express consent. However, when it comes to prosecuting international robocallers, the landscape becomes significantly more complex.
DC-based robocall law firms play a crucial role in navigating these complexities due to their expertise in both US and international telecommunications laws. These lawyers must understand that while the TCPA sets standards for domestic calls, international regulations vary widely from country to country. Many nations have implemented strict anti-spam measures, but enforcement and liability frameworks differ, making it difficult to pursue overseas robocallers through traditional legal channels. As global communication continues to evolve, a deep understanding of both local and international robocall laws is essential for effective prosecution and consumer protection.

Legal Challenges: Jurisdiction and Cross-Border Prosecution
The prosecution of overseas robocallers presents significant legal challenges, particularly in navigating jurisdiction and cross-border prosecution. With the global reach of telecommunications, it has become increasingly difficult to trace and hold accountable the perpetrators behind unsolicited automated calls. One of the primary obstacles is determining the applicable jurisdiction—a complex matter when calls originate from one country but target individuals or businesses in another. In this digital age, a DC robocall law firm must be adept at interpreting international laws and treaties governing cybersecurity and data privacy to establish legal grounds for prosecution.
Cross-border cooperation is another critical aspect, as it often requires coordinating with foreign authorities who may have different legal systems and procedures. Effective communication and understanding of mutual legal assistance treaties are essential to ensure the successful pursuit of robocallers operating in multiple jurisdictions. This intricate web of international laws demands a sophisticated approach from DC’s robocall law firms to protect victims and deter these persistent global scammers.
